Release & Drop Device
A Release & Drop Device is a remotely controlled mechanism, typically mounted on a drone or unmanned system, designed to carry and precisely release a payload during flight or operation. It can be a mechanical claw, electromagnet, hook, or servo-activated mechanism that securely holds an item (like a life vest, medical supplies, sensor package, or marker) and releases it on command from the operator. This accessory dramatically expands the utility of drones from mere observation platforms to active delivery or deployment systems for search and rescue, logistics, agriculture (seed/fertilizer dispersal), and military applications.
